Modified SCRT Followed by Tislelizumab Plus CAPOX for Locally Advanced Rectal Cancer

Completed Phase 2 Last updated 15 August 2025
What this trial tests

Phase 2 trial testing Short-course Radiotherapy in Mid-low Rectal Cancer in 38 participants. Completed in 14 August 2025.

Who can join

Adults 18 to 75, any sex, with Mid-low Rectal Cancer. Patients with the condition only — healthy volunteers not accepted.

Sponsor's own description

To explore the complete response (CR) rate of modified short-course radiotherapy combined with CAPOX and tislelizumab for locally Advanced Mid-low Rectal Cancer
